SUMMARY/DISCUSSION:

The Cannabis Program (Program) informed the Board of Supervisors Cannabis Committee (Committee) and the Board of Supervisors (Board) of the Department of Cannabis Control (DCC) Local Jurisdiction Assistance Grant (LJAG) opportunity on July 21, 2021 and October 12, 2021 respectively. Through the LJAG, the DCC intends to provide grant funding to local jurisdictions to assist local commercial cannabis operators with transitioning from provisional to annual state licensure. The Program submitted an LJAG application on November 10, 2021 and received notification on December 24, 2021 for an award amount of $1,737,025 to be expended from January 1, 2022 through June 30, 2025. In January 2022, the Board adopted a resolution authorizing the County Administrative Officer to execute a grant agreement with the DCC.

 

In August 2022, staff presented proposed amendments to Chapters 20.69 and 21.69 of Monterey County Code (MCC), which pertain to the Outdoor Commercial Cannabis Cultivation Pilot Program (Pilot). Staff recommended to remove the requirement for proof of prior cultivation, as this would expand the pool of eligible applicants, however the Board did not agree to this recommendation. Instead, it directed staff to return to the Board with recommended amendments to the LJAG budget. Staff recommends the following amended LJAG budget as follows:

 

                     Increase Accela Automation improvements to $100,000.

o                     Staff is completing the Cannabis Business Permit module and has discovered reporting requirements need improvement.

o                     Ordinance work related to MCC Ordinances Titles 20.67, 21.67, 20.69, 21.69, and Chapter 7.90 will continue with an outside consultant.

o                     Staff has removed the consultant function to assist with the implementation of the Go-Biz and LJAG grants as it was unsuccessful in identifying an appropriate temporary staff person.

o                     The remaining dollars will be adjusted to the passthrough funding for operators who hold a provisional state license and desire to transition to annual licensure.

 

Staff have conferred with Housing and Community Development to reallocate the grant budget according to Attachment A.

FINANCING:

Monterey County’s Cannabis Program is funded in County Administrative Office - Department 1050, Intergovernmental and Legislative Affairs Division - Unit 8533, Cannabis. Approval of this recommendation will not result in additional general fund contributions.
